some VERY basic advice on adaptersOK, most of you will probably laugh but... I have a (digital) Kodak Z730 and need a wide angle. If I buy the recommended 37-52mm adapter, would that let me use *any* 52mm lens -- even my old 35mm film SLR's? BTW loved the article about making a pinhole camera out of an SLR. Thanks. rick I think you are talking about a 37mm to 52mm step-up ring, right? If so, then you can use any accessory lenses with 52mm threads on it. Search for "accessory lens" on this site to see what I'm talking about. Most lenses for 35mm SLR cameras have a bayonet mount at the end. It's proprietary to the camera manufacturer, so they probably won't work. Chieh Cheng Boy that's a bummer... too bad they're proprietary.
